About This Item

Vancouver, BC: Press Gang Publishers, 1997. Miniscule rubbing, bumping or shelfwear to wraps. Spine straight and uncreased. Interior tight and unmarked except copyright symbol and three initials in small red ink on half-title page, crisp. Apparently unread. As new but for inked marking. A novel of urban lesbians wondering when you tell the person you're dating that you have Multiple Sclerosis or that you have been in a psych ward. In other words when do you reveal your darkest secrets?. First. Trade Paperback. Fine/No Jacket as Issued.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all.

Glossary

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:

Tight
Used to mean that the binding of a book has not been overly loosened by frequent use.
Rubbing
Abrasion or wear to the surface. Usually used in reference to a book's boards or dust-jacket.

Shelfwear
Minor wear resulting from a book being place on, and taken from a bookshelf, especially along the bottom edge.
